Question raised in Lok Sabha on Allocation of Power, 28/07/2016. As per the information reported by the States to Central Electricity Authority (CEA), Energy Shortage at all India level was reduced to 2.1% during the year 2015-16 which is the lowest in last two decades. During the current year 2016-17 (April, 2016 to June 2016), Energy Shortage has further reduced to 0.9%. The Lok Sabha passed the Lokpal and Lokayukta (Amendment) Bill, 2016. The bill seeks to amend the Lokpal and Lokayukta Act, 2013 which provides Lokpal (at Centre) and Lokayukta (at States) statutory backing to inquire into allegations of corruption against certain public functionaries and for related matters.

The CAG has picked holes in the e-auction of coal mines by the NDA government last year saying multiple bids by corporate groups through joint ventures or subsidiaries did not give an assurance that potential level of competition was achieved in the first two tranches.

Question raised in Lok Sabha on Special Economic Zones, 25/07/2016. In addition to 7 Central Government Special Economic Zones (SEZs) and 11 State/Private Sector SEZs set-up prior to the enactment of the SEZ Act, 2005, approval has been accorded to 412 SEZs, out of which 204 SEZs are functional and remaining 226 SEZs are non-functional as on date.
